Forces of 86 N east, 23 N north, 46 N south, 55 N west are simultaneously applied to a box of mass 13.8 kg. Find the magnitude of the box's acceleration?

2 answers

x: F(x) =86-55 = 31 N (east)
y: F(y) = 46-23 =23 N (south)
a(x) = F(x)/m =31/13.8 =2.25 m/s² (east)
a(y) = F(y)/m =23/13.8 =1.67 m/s² (south)

The last line is

a= sqrt(a(x)² + a(y) ²) = sqrt(2.25²+1.67²)=
= 2.8 m/s² (to the south of east)
